Technical Specifications
Understanding the technical specifications of the GX3 Hilti Nail Gun is essential for safe and efficient operation:
-
Power Source: The GX3 is a pneumatic nail gun, requiring a compatible air compressor for operation.
-
Nail Size: It accommodates standard 16-gauge straight collated nails ranging from 1-1/4 inches to 2-1/2 inches in length.
-
Magazine Capacity: The magazine can typically hold up to 40 nails, reducing the frequency of reloads.
-
Operating Pressure: The recommended operating pressure for the GX3 is between 80 to 120 PSI (pounds per square inch). Ensure your air compressor can provide this range.
-
Weight: The GX3 is designed to be lightweight, typically weighing around 5 pounds, minimizing operator fatigue during extended use.
Operating Instructions
Using the GX3 Hilti Nail Gun effectively requires following a few simple steps:
-
Safety Precautions: Always wear appropriate safety gear, including safety glasses and hearing protection.
-
Load Nails: Open the magazine and load the nails with the nail heads facing down. Close the magazine door securely.
-
Connect Air Hose: Connect the air hose to the nail gun and ensure that the air compressor is set to the recommended operating pressure (80-120 PSI).
-
Select Nail Depth: Adjust the depth control dial on the nail gun to set the desired nail depth. Test a few shots to ensure the correct depth.
-
Aim and Fire: Place the nail gun’s nose against the workpiece and press the safety tip against the surface. Pull the trigger to drive a nail. Release the trigger and safety tip after each shot.
-
Maintenance: Regularly clean the nail gun’s air filter and lubricate it with pneumatic tool oil to ensure smooth operation. Keep the magazine free from debris.
Uses
The GX3 Hilti Nail Gun is a versatile tool suitable for a range of applications, including:
-
Interior Finishing: Perfect for installing baseboards, crown molding, and other finish work.
-
Cabinet Installation: Ideal for securing cabinets to walls and frames.
-
Framing: Suitable for light framing work, such as constructing walls and partitions.
-
Woodworking: The GX3 is capable of handling various wood thicknesses, making it versatile for woodworking projects.
-
Sheathing: Effective for attaching sheathing panels and other structural components.
